    The European Union Delegation to the Federal Republic of Somalia is seeking to recruit a Section Assistant for the Peace Building, Democratisation and Security Sector Reform section. This is a local position based in Nairobi, Kenya.
    Duration: The contract is initially for a period until 31/12/2015 with a probationary period of three months and possibility of renewal for 12 months.
    Overall purpose:
    To assist the Peace Building and Security Sector Reform section in the effective and efficient management of development programs in Somalia as well as in organizing internal processes in the following areas:
    Administration Support
  • Support the Head of Section in the management of the section processes, e.g. preparation and update of leave, missions and trainings, organization of meetings etc.
  • Maintain and update the section's contacts of implementing partners and donors active in Somalia in coordination
  • Drafting, transcribing and processing minutes of meetings, memos and other correspondence.
  • Providing logistics support to missions/trainings including making the necessary travel and accommodation reservations and appointments
  • Managing the flow of information, communication and technology
  • Organize missions and post missions actions, including providing logistics support
  • Filing and keeping a systematic record of all projects, correspondence and other files including archivingProgram/Process/Project Management - Delegation's project cycle management
  • Assist in preparation of tenders, calls for proposals and contractual documents Compile and update project related files and documents
  • Assist in monitoring implementation of work-plan including project implementation (start-up events, deadlines, reporting)
  • Follow-up with Finance & Contracts on timely payments, budget amendments and riders
  • In conjunction with other sections, update the EU project database on a regular basis and assist in encoding contract data in the Common Relex Information System (CRIS)
  • In liaison with Program Managers prepare relevant information, press releases fact sheets, presentation of activities of the section
  • Assist in planning and reporting requirements such as the AAP, EAMR and ad hoc reportsEligibility Criteria
  • Diploma level in Business Administration and/or Secretarial Studies
  • Minimum 5 years' experience in secretarial management/administration of which 3 years' should be in an international office environment; Experience in development cooperation processes will be an added advantage.Other Qualifications
  • Ability to build and maintain positive working relationships with colleagues, national counterparts, donor agencies, other stakeholders and ability to adapt well in a multi-cultural environment.
  • Excellent written and spoken English (working language).
  • Excellent oral and written presentation skills; Good IT skills required.
  • Personal initiative and ability to focus on priorities and meet deadlines.
  • Open, flexible personality; excellent ability to perform duties with accuracy within a given deadline.
  • A high degree of integrity and the ability to deal with confidential information is requiredThe position is open to nationals and other residents of Kenya with a valid working permit (compulsory).
